How Robot Vacuum and Mop Cleaners Work: A Symphony of Sensors and Smart Technology

Robot vacuum and mop cleaners are sophisticated devices that utilize a combination of sensors, algorithms, and mechanical components to navigate and tidy floors autonomously. While the specific innovation may vary in between models and brands, the fundamental concepts stay consistent.

At their core, these robotics depend on a suite of sensors to perceive their environment. These sensors can include:
Bump sensing units: Detect collisions with challenges, triggering the robot to change direction.Cliff sensors: Prevent the robot from dropping stairs or ledges by detecting drops in elevation.Wall sensing units: Allow the robot to follow walls and edges for extensive cleaning.Optical and infrared sensors: Used for navigation, mapping, and things detection, helping the robot create efficient cleaning paths and avoid barriers.Gyroscope and accelerometer: Help the robot track its movement and orientation, adding to accurate navigation and area coverage.
These sensors feed data to an onboard computer system that processes info and directs the robot's movement. Lots of modern robot vacuum and mops use innovative navigation technologies such as:
Random Bounce Navigation: Older and simpler models often utilize this method, moving randomly up until they encounter a challenge, then changing instructions. While less effective, they can still cover a location over time.Organized Navigation: More advanced robotics utilize organized cleaning patterns, such as zig-zag or spiral movements, to ensure more total and effective coverage.Smart Mapping: High-end designs include innovative mapping capabilities, often utilizing LiDAR (Light Detection and Ranging) or vSLAM (visual Simultaneous Localization and Mapping). These technologies permit robotics to produce in-depth maps of the home, allowing them to clean specific spaces, set virtual borders, and find out the layout for optimized cleaning paths.
The cleaning process itself involves 2 main functions: vacuuming and mopping.
Vacuuming: Robot vacuums utilize brushes to loosen debris from the floor and an effective suction motor to draw dirt, dust, pet hair, and other particles into a dustbin. Various brush types and suction levels accommodate different floor types, from difficult floorings to carpets.Mopping: Robot mops typically include a water tank and a mopping pad. The robot dispenses water onto the pad, which then wipes the floor. Some designs use vibrating or oscillating mopping pads for more effective stain removal. Different mopping modes and water flow settings are frequently offered to fit different floor types and cleaning needs.

Browsing the Options: Types of Robot Vacuum and Mops

The robot vacuum and mop market varies, using different models with different performances. Here's a general classification to assist comprehend the choices:
Robot Vacuums Only: These are dedicated vacuuming robots that focus exclusively on dry cleaning. They are typically more cost effective and often use robust vacuuming efficiency.2-in-1 Robot Vacuum and Mops: These flexible devices integrate both vacuuming and mopping functionalities. They provide convenience and space-saving benefits, though mopping performance might be less intensive than dedicated robot mops in some designs.Committed Robot Mops: These robotics are specifically created for mopping difficult floorings. They often feature more sophisticated mopping systems, such as vibrating pads and precise water giving control, for efficient damp cleaning.Self-Emptying Robot Vacuums: These premium designs include a charging base that also works as a dustbin. When the robot's dustbin is complete, it immediately empties into the larger base dustbin, considerably minimizing manual emptying frequency.Smart Robot Vacuums and Mops: These innovative robots are equipped with smart functions like Wi-Fi connection, mobile phone app control, voice assistant integration (e.g., Alexa, Google Assistant), room mapping, and virtual no-go zones.

Preserving Your Robot Vacuum and Mop: Ensuring Longevity and Performance

To ensure your robot vacuum and mop runs efficiently and lasts for years, regular maintenance is necessary. Secret upkeep tasks include:
Emptying the Dustbin: Empty the dustbin routinely, ideally after each cleaning cycle, to maintain ideal suction efficiency.Cleaning or Replacing Filters: Clean or replace filters according to the producer's recommendations. Clogged up filters minimize suction and cleaning performance.Cleaning Brushes: Remove hair and particles tangled in the brushes regularly. Some designs come with tools particularly developed for brush cleaning.Cleaning Mop Pads: Wash or replace mop pads after each mopping cycle to keep health and cleaning efficiency.Cleaning Sensors: Periodically clean the robot's sensors with a soft, dry cloth to make sure precise navigation and obstacle detection.Checking for Obstructions: Regularly inspect the robot's course for possible obstructions like cable televisions or small items that might get twisted.
By following these easy upkeep steps, you can guarantee your robot vacuum and mop continues to supply dependable and effective cleaning for many years to come.

Regularly Asked Questions (FAQs) about Robot Vacuum and Mop Cleaners

Q1: Are robot vacuum and mops as reliable as conventional vacuum and mops?
Robot vacuums and mops are generally reliable for everyday cleaning and maintenance. They may not be as powerful as high-end standard vacuum cleaners for deep cleaning extremely thick carpets or getting rid of greatly ingrained stains. However, for regular upkeep and preserving a tidy home, they are highly effective and hassle-free.
Q2: Can robot vacuum and mops clean up all types of floors?
Most robot vacuums and mops are designed to clean hard floors like hardwood, tile, laminate, and linoleum. Many designs can also handle low-pile carpets and carpets. Nevertheless, incredibly plush or high-pile carpets may pose challenges for some robots. Always check the manufacturer's requirements relating to floor types.
Q3: Do robot vacuum and mops require Wi-Fi to operate?
Standard robot vacuum and mops without smart functions can operate without Wi-Fi. Nevertheless, designs with Wi-Fi connectivity offer improved features like mobile phone app control, scheduling, room mapping, and voice assistant integration. Wi-Fi is essential to make use of these Smart home vacuum performances.
Q4: How long do robot vacuum and mops usually last?
The life expectancy of a robot vacuum and mop depends upon use, maintenance, and the quality of the gadget. With appropriate upkeep, an excellent quality robot vacuum and mop can last for numerous years, typically ranging from 3 to 5 years or even longer.
Q5: Are robot vacuum and mops noisy?
Robot vacuums and mops normally produce less noise than conventional vacuum. Sound levels vary in between designs, however numerous are created to operate quietly enough not to be disruptive throughout regular household activities.
Q6: Can robot vacuum and mops clean pet hair effectively?
Yes, numerous robot vacuums are particularly designed for pet hair elimination. Try to find models with functions like strong suction, tangle-free brushes, and bigger dustbins, which are especially effective at picking up pet hair and dander.
Q7: What occurs if a robot vacuum and mop gets stuck?
Modern robot vacuum and mops are equipped with sensing units and challenge avoidance innovation to lessen getting stuck. However, they might periodically get stuck on loose cable televisions, small objects, or in tight corners. Lots of models will immediately stop and send a notice if they get stuck.
Q8: Do I require to prepare my home before using a robot vacuum and mop?
It's advised to declutter floorings by removing small things, cable televisions, and loose products that could obstruct the robot or get tangled in the brushes. Hiding chair legs and raising drapes can likewise enhance cleaning performance.
Q9: Can robot vacuum and mops climb over thresholds?
Many robot vacuum and mops can climb up over low thresholds, generally around 0.5 to 0.75 inches. Nevertheless, higher limits might prevent them from moving between spaces. Examine the maker's requirements for threshold climbing capability.
